Earth"s internal structure: earth is divided into three major layers, crust- earth"s thin, rocky outer skin, mantle- approx. 2900 km thick and composed of peridotite (fe, mg silicates: core- is composed of iron (ni, co, s, most of our knowledge of earth"s interior comes from the study of seismic waves. Information also comes from: meteorites, density calculations, heat flow, high pressure experiments. 7kms tick and composed of basalt (fe, mg & al rich rock: continental crust- 30 to 70 km and composed primarily of granite (si rich rock) Interior layers of the earth based on composition. Complex rocks- overall granitic (al, silicates with na, ca, mg, fe. Interior layers of the earth based on physical properties. Seismology: the study of earthquakes and of seismic waves as they pass through the earth. Focus- source of energy release: epicenter- on the surface directly above the focus.
